It was back in 2009 when an Illinois woman began to care for a raccoon that frequented her backyard. Her home was boarded by a heavily wooded area, so it was fairly easy for him to come and go as he pleased. It wasn’t long, however, before Eryn noticed her new friend displaying some quite odd behavior. Especially the day he returned with not one, but two bodyguards!

Not only would the raccoon venture out during the daytime, but he could also be seen bumping into things, and getting easily spooked by everyday, normal noises. Then she saw what could be causing this unusual behavior, his eyes would glow bright green during the day!

“There is something wrong with his tapetum lucidum. His eyes shine bright green during the day. He is at least partially blind. He walks into things. He is afraid of the wind, high grass, birds, and snow,” Eryn explains.

After realizing he was at the very least partially blind, Eryn began to leave out small meals on the back porch for her visitor. He would usually turn up between the hours of 6.00 am to 9.00 am, often returning for seconds or even thirds! With his bottom lip missing she would feed him soft noodles soaked in cream of chicken soup.

Also sometimes dishing out hot dogs, or ham and pork. Quite discerning about what he would eat, he would turn up his nose at canned cat/dog food.

Eryn was also was quite firm about pointing out her raccoon doesn’t have rabies or distemper. Going on to explain raccoons quite often venture forth during daylight hours in early summer, especially after giving birth. Also if he had had either disease he would have died a long time ago.
